Pancake Holsters: The Versatile Option

Pancake holsters are a popular choice for OWB carry. These holsters feature two flat sides that press against the body, providing excellent concealment. The design distributes the weight of the firearm evenly, enhancing comfort during extended wear. Pancake holsters are versatile and suitable for both open and concealed carry.

Paddle Holsters: Easy On, Easy Off

If convenience is a priority, consider a paddle holster. This style features a contoured paddle that attaches to the outside of the pants, allowing for quick and effortless removal without having to undo your belt. Paddle holsters are ideal for those who take their firearm on and off frequently, such as range enthusiasts.

Retention Holsters: Security First

Security is paramount when carrying a firearm; retention holsters are designed with this in mind. These holsters feature additional mechanisms, such as thumb breaks or retention screws, to secure the gun in place. While this adds an extra layer of security, practicing drawing from a retention holster is essential to ensure a smooth and quick response in any situation.

Tactical Holsters: Ready for Action

Tactical holsters are an excellent choice for those who prioritize a quick draw and easy re-holstering. These holsters often feature an open-top design, allowing for a swift and natural interest. Additionally, many tactical holsters come with adjustable cant and retention systems, allowing you to customize the holster to your preferred drawing angle and security level.

Holster Materials: Leather vs. Kydex

When choosing an OWB holster, consider the material it's made from. Leather holsters offer a classic and comfortable option, molding to the shape of your firearm over time. On the other hand, Kydex holsters are known for their durability and trigger guard coverage. Your choice between leather and Kydex will depend on personal preference and the level of protection you desire for your firearm.
